AvailableStuart is a young male Domestic Short Hair, about 2 years and 3 months old, with a warm brown coat. He’s medium-sized, neutered, vaccinated, and house trained. Stuart is FeLV positive and needs a quiet, single-cat household in Raleigh, NC where someone can give him the extra care and love he deserves.
About Stuart
Stuart is a gentle, affectionate tabby with just one eye who has completely mastered the art of snuggling. He wants nothing more than to be close to his people, whether it’s napping on your chest, curling up in your lap, or stretching out in a sunny spot. Stuart stays close during the day and makes a wonderful office buddy—he’ll supervise your work and soak up all the chin scratches and attention you can give. He loves playing with catnip mice, birdwatching from the window, and showing his appreciation for canned food with loud purrs. He does best in a quiet home where someone is usually around, and he gets along well with older, gentle children. While he may tolerate a mellow dog, he can't live with other cats due to FeLV.
